What Are Keywords?
Keywords are the words that your audience is using on different search engine platforms searching various services and products. Keywords are a main element in SEO, these can be one word and also a long phrase.
- The main keyword, also called the focus or primary keyword, is the main keyword/phrase through which you want your blog post to be found.
- The long phrase keywords are called long-tail keywords; these keyword types have less volume but are easier to rank.

1. Understand Different Types of Keywords
Before jumping straight into finding the desired keyword for your business, know and understand about different types of keywords. There are different categories in keywords based on their length which indicates their search volume and demand among potential customers.
Short, Seed, or Broad Keywords: These are the most popular blog SEO keywords with generally one or two words. However, they are highly competitive and have high search traffic. For example, “workout”. There is no specification of what type of workout the individual is looking for.
Mid-Tail Keywords: These are generally three or four-word keywords that appear in more specific searches. Unlike short keywords, these are less competitive and easy to rank. For example, “workout for men.”
Long-Tail Keywords: Long-tail keywords are descriptive and similar to phrases in length. They usually don’t easily appear or rank in search results at the same time; they are excellent at targeting the exact kind of searches the client would make.

3. Conduct Effective Keyword Research
Keyword research for blogs reveals what competitors are targeting and which keywords are commonly used. Keyword research can be done manually through Google searches. Suppose you need help identifying blog SEO keywords. In that case, you can use various keyword research tools like Moz Keyword Explorer, Ahrefs, ChatGPT, and many more, which will help you find keywords that would be beneficial to your targets. You can reveal new keywords, keyword density, and their search volume using this tool.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: What is the first step in choosing keywords for blog posts?
A1: The first step is to create a giant keyword list. Don’t worry about competition in the beginning. The priority should be to get a bunch of keywords.
Q2: How do you identify a primary keyword?
A2: A primary keyword has a high search volume, and it can bring a huge amount of traffic to the website.
Q3: What is keyword competition?
A3: A keyword competition is a metric that measures how difficult it is to rank a specific keyword in search engines.
Q4: What is the keyword density of 100 words?
A4: A specific keyword should appear 1.5 times for every 100 words in your content. To calculate it, count the number of times the keyword is used, divide that by the total word count, and then multiply by 100.
Q5: What are the target audience keywords?
A5: Target audience keywords are the phrases that your targeted audience or potential customers use in search engines for searching information for products or services.
